Was ist neu in der WSL in Windows 10, September 2020
Microsoft hat ein veröffentlicht dokumentieren das die Änderungen abdeckt, die im September 2020 am Windows-Subsystem für Linux in Windows 10 vorgenommen wurden. Der Beitrag erwähnt Kernel-Updates über Windows Update, die Verfügbarkeit von WSL 2 unter Windows 10, Version 1909 und 1903, und einige andere interessante Verbesserungen, die an der Funktion vorgenommen wurden.
WSL 2 ist eine neue Version der Architektur, die das Windows-Subsystem für Linux antreibt, um ELF64-Linux-Binärdateien unter Windows auszuführen. Diese neue Architektur ändert, wie diese Linux-Binärdateien mit Windows und Ihrem Computer interagieren Hardware, bietet aber immer noch die gleiche Benutzererfahrung wie in WSL 1 (der derzeit weit verbreiteten Ausführung).
Werbung
Es liefert einen echten Linux-Kernel mit Windows aus, der volle Systemaufrufkompatibilität ermöglicht. Dies ist das erste Mal, dass ein Linux-Kernel mit Windows ausgeliefert wird. WSL 2 verwendet die neueste Virtualisierungstechnologie, um seinen Linux-Kernel in einer schlanken virtuellen Utility-Maschine (VM) auszuführen.
WSL 2-Unterstützung ist jetzt in Windows 10 Version 1903 und 1909 verfügbar
WSL 2, die Next-Get-Implementierung der Linux-Schicht für Windows 10, war exklusiv für Windows-Version 2004 verfügbar. Um es für mehr Windows 10-Benutzer verfügbar zu machen, hat Microsoft zur Verfügung gestellt für zwei frühere Versionen des Betriebssystems.
Update zum Ausführen von Linux-GUI-Apps in WSL
Microsoft nähert sich einer ersten Vorschau dieser Funktion und wird in den nächsten Monaten eine Vorschauversion für Windows Insider ankündigen.
Unten ist ein früher Blick auf einen internen Build Ausführen von GUI-Apps in WSL. Sie können sehen, dass WSL viele verschiedene Arten von Anwendungen unterstützt, einschließlich IDEs, die vollständig in einer Linux-Umgebung ausgeführt werden. Die Entwickler haben viele Details zur Passform und Verarbeitung hinzugefügt, z. B. die Anzeige der Symbole für Linux-Apps in der Taskleiste und die Unterstützung von Audio mit Ihrem Mikrofon. Unten ist die native Linux-Version von Microsoft Teams, die in WSL ausgeführt wird.
WSL – Installation mit Distributionsunterstützung kommt bald zu Insiders
Auf der BUILD 2020 Konferenz hat Microsoft eine neue Kommandozeilenoption vorgestellt, wsl --install
. Die erste Iteration dieser Funktion ist derzeit in Windows Insider-Builds von Windows 10 verfügbar. In den nächsten Wochen wird die --Installieren
Argument beinhaltet die Möglichkeit, WSL-Distributionen zu installieren, was bedeutet, dass Sie WSL zusammen mit Ihrer gewählten Distribution mit nur einem Befehl vollständig auf Ihrem Computer einrichten können.
Zugriff auf Linux-Dateisysteme mit WSL
Beginnen mit Windows Insiders Preview-Build 20211, WSL 2 bietet eine neue Funktion: wsl --mount
. Dieser neue Parameter ermöglicht das Anhängen und Mounten einer physischen Festplatte in WSL 2, sodass Sie auf Dateisysteme zugreifen können, die von Windows nicht nativ unterstützt werden (z. B. ext4). Sie können auch im Windows-Datei-Explorer zu diesen Dateien navigieren.
Um mehr über diese Funktion zu erfahren, lesen Sie die WSL 2-Mount-Disk-Dokumentation oder Ankündigung Blogbeitrag.
Open-Sourcing von TensorFlow mit DirectML
WSL bietet Unterstützung für GPU-Computing-Workflows, die jetzt in Windows Insiders-Builds verfügbar sind. Weitere Informationen zu dieser Änderung und den ersten Schritten finden Sie in den offiziellen Dokumenten: GPU-beschleunigtes Machine-Learning-Training. Darüber hinaus hat Microsoft den Quellcode von TensorFlow-DirectML, einer Erweiterung von TensorFlow unter Windows, als Open-Source-Projekt auf Github öffentlich zugänglich gemacht. TensorFlow-DirectML erweitert die Reichweite von TensorFlow über die traditionelle Unterstützung von Graphics Processing Unit (GPU) hinaus, indem es aktiviert Hochleistungstraining und Inferencing von Machine-Learning-Modellen auf beliebigen Windows-Geräten mit einer DirectX 12-fähigen GPU durch DirectML. DirectML ist eine hardwarebeschleunigte Deep-Learning-API unter Windows. Weitere Informationen zu dieser Änderung finden Sie auf der Ankündigungs-Blogpost.
Linux-Kernelversionen werden jetzt automatisch über Microsoft Update für WSL aktualisiert
Mit Version 2004 hat Microsoft den Linux-Kernel aus dem Windows-Betriebssystem-Image entfernt und wird stattdessen Bereitstellung auf Ihrem PC über Windows Update, auf die gleiche Weise wie bei Treibern von Drittanbietern (wie Grafik oder Touchpad). Fahrer). Sie können manuell nach neuen Kernel-Updates suchen, indem Sie auf die Schaltfläche "Nach Updates suchen" klicken, oder Sie können sich von Windows wie gewohnt auf dem Laufenden halten lassen.
Die neuen Kernel-Versionen sind nicht mehr nur für Windows-Insider, jetzt erhält jedes Gerät, das WSL aktiviert hat und sich für Microsoft Updates angemeldet hat, automatisch die neueste Kernel-Version! Die Versionshistorie des Linux-Kernels finden Sie in den WSL-Dokumenten.